Professor Albert Einstein of the University of Berlin, the world's famous mathematical physicist will deliver five lectures on his "Theory of Relativity", beginning Monday, May 9th at Princeton. The subject of his five lecture will be as follows:
Monday, and Tuesday May 9th and 10th. Theory of Relativity.
Wednesday, May 11th.--The Special Theory of Relativity.
Thursday, May 12th--The General Theory of Relativity and Gravitation.
Friday, May 13th. Explanation of "Cosmological Speculations".
Over 600 invitations to attend the great scientist's lectures and to be present at the formal academic welcome extended to him by the Princeton Faculty has been sent to the presidents of all colleges and universities in the United States.
